Newcastle-Gateshead Marathon, Half Marathon, 10k, & Juniors Presented by Nuun Hydration on Sunday 3rd May 2026 In Support of The Bubble Foundation

This fully road-closed course takes you past some of Gateshead’s most recognisable landmarks, including the Gateshead Millennium Bridge, The Glasshouse International Centre for Music, BALTIC, Tyne Bridge and Swing Bridge, before finishing at the iconic Gateshead International Stadium.

Gateshead International Stadium is the third-largest sporting venue in Tyne and Wear and the North East’s only IAAF-standard athletics stadium. It has hosted Diamond League and European Cup events, welcoming some of the world’s greatest athletes. By crossing the finish line here, you will be following in the footsteps of World Champions and Olympians, on a track where five world records have been broken.

The course

This fully road-closed route takes in some of Gateshead’s best-known landmarks, including the Gateshead Millennium Bridge, The Glasshouse ICM, BALTIC, Tyne Bridge and Swing Bridge, before finishing inside the iconic Gateshead International Stadium. You will complete a lap of the track and cross the finish line cheered on by family and friends.
